Cabbagetown is a former working-class area of Toronto, so named because the Irish-Catholic inhabitants cooked a lot of boiled cabbage - the smell was said to permeate the streets.
Now many of the Victorian rowhouses have been bought by Yuppies and the area is becoming quite gentrified.
